This position reports to a Court of Appeals Judge in Raleigh, North Carolina. Work hours are typically 8:00 AM - 5:00 PM, Monday - Friday. The ideal start date will be no later than November 15, 2026. This position is not remote.
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ities / Competencies
Knowledge of: N.C. General Statutes; N.C. Rules of Appellate Procedure; N.C. Supreme Court and Court of Appeals case law; N.C. Rules of Appellate and Civil Procedure; and some federal statutes and case law.
Ability to: conduct legal research and analysis; draft appellate opinions; and comprehend abstract legal concepts.
